The City of Virginia: A History of Renewal & Strength and Rebuilding

From its origins as a strategic trading post on the James River in the 18th century, Lynchburg, Virginia, has consistently demonstrated an extraordinary capacity for overcoming adversity. The city survived the devastation of the Civil War, including multiple Union army incursions that left scars on its infrastructure. Following Reconstruction, Lynchburg slowly but surely rebuilt itself, becoming a vital industrial hub fueled by the railroad and later, the automotive industry. Despite facing economic difficulties throughout the 20th and 21st centuries, including the decline of traditional industries, Lynchburg has persistently shown a commitment to progress, embracing new technologies and fostering a vibrant arts scene. Today, Lynchburg stands as a testament to the enduring spirit of its residents, a place where history and contemporary life intertwine, constantly demonstrating its power to adapt and thrive.

A Chronicle of Lynchburg

Lynchburg, Virginia, boasts a rich history, a testament to its adaptability through changing times. Initially, established as a trading post at the confluence of the James and Blackwater rivers, the city quickly grew thanks to its strategic position for business. During the 19th century, Lynchburg expanded as a major center for the agricultural industry and a vital railway center, though the echoes of the Civil War, including significant Confederate presence and a difficult post-war period, left an indelible mark. Contemporary Lynchburg is now cultivating a renewed focus on arts, culture, and education, while carefully maintaining its historical legacy. This unique blend of past and present makes Lynchburg a truly interesting place to explore.
